企业官网要新增一个英文版,用子目录还是二级域名合适?

2021-05-22 16:17:35 +08:00
 libasten

主要是考虑对收索引擎的友好程度,让人家好搜索到。

子目录最后呈现的 URL 就是 http://www.xxx.com/en

二级域名的 URL 就是 http://en.xxx.com

看了一些大型跨国企业的官网,似乎两种都有。

有大佬对这方面熟悉的吗?

1913 次点击
所在节点    问与答
10 条回复
Jirajine
2021-05-22 16:23:03 +08:00
什么都不用,根据语言设置 /浏览器头自动返回对应语言的页面。
要不然你所有页面每加一种语言都要改?
libasten
2021-05-22 16:27:17 +08:00
@Jirajine 这种“动态”的对搜索引擎不太友好吧。
learningman
2021-05-22 16:28:17 +08:00
@Jirajine CI 呗
Jirajine
2021-05-22 16:37:04 +08:00
@libasten #2 到也是。那就用子目录吧,一种语言的界面全都放到一个子目录下,像这样 https://docs.microsoft.com/en-us/dotnet/ ,不带目录的请求根据语言设置 /浏览器头跳转。
分子域名相当于单独的网站了,肯定要差一些。但如果你代码里大量使用绝对路径不好更改那分子域名比较省事。
Tumblr
2021-05-22 16:45:41 +08:00
为什么前面你可以打成“收索引擎”而后面修正回“搜索”呢? 🤣
推荐前者,不过如果为了搜索的话直接在中文网站上做 SEO 优化,提供一些英文的 keywords 不就行了么,干吗还要弄个官网。。。说不定翻译得太差反而起到负面效果。
libasten
2021-05-22 16:59:16 +08:00
@Tumblr 感谢指点。
翻译其实不担心,哈哈,我为了说的直白符合国情,把中英文颠倒了说的,原本是个英文网站,现在想要增加一个国内中文版。
现在想要服务多个语言的用户,还是建立多个网站好点。
Tianao
2021-05-22 17:48:54 +08:00
感觉 IT 大厂都是用子目录的。
pcbl
2021-05-22 18:30:39 +08:00
子域名吧,可以独立的去部署解析,比如给子域名单独选个适合国内的线路,或者直接放国内
opengps
2021-05-22 19:49:17 +08:00
看你出发点,如果你想分开独立部署,子域名更合适,如果你是一个源站,那么用二级目录似乎更受欢迎
kchum
2021-05-23 19:30:27 +08:00
子域名更适合吧,毕竟有可能中文网站由于各种因素需要国内服务器解决中文用户访问问题。

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/778542

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X